About agriculture in Cinco de Febrero
Located in the state of Campeche, Cinco de Febrero is situated in a region characterized by its flat coastal plains and lush tropical vegetation. The surrounding landscape features a mix of dense low-growth forests and cleared agricultural fields, typical of the Yucatan Peninsula's southern reaches.
The local economy is rooted in traditional and commercial farming, with a focus on crops such as maize, sorghum, and various tropical fruits. Cattle ranching is also a significant activity, with pastures carved out of the tropical landscape to support hardy breeds adapted to the warm, humid climate.
For agronomists and seasonal workers, the area offers opportunities primarily tied to the planting and harvesting cycles of grain and fruit crops. Employment is often found in local cooperatives or medium-sized ranches, where knowledge of tropical soil management and pest control is highly valued during the peak growing seasons.
